Anonymous Emails Alleged to Expose New Evidence in Christian Horner Case

Almost exactly 24 hours after Christian Horner was cleared of wrongdoing following allegations made by a female employee, a pair of anonymous email addresses distributed a dossier of documents related to the case. The emails, sent to over 100 people including senior figures within the Formula 1 organization, contained a link to a Google Drive file with the alleged materials.

While Red Bull has not confirmed the authenticity of the documents, the wide distribution of the dossier indicates that there are individuals eager to discredit Horner despite his clearance. The timing of the anonymous emails, just one day after the investigation’s conclusion and during F1 car running, suggests an attempt to further tarnish Horner’s reputation.

The investigation into Horner was initially prompted by a complaint from a female employee. However, the public exposure of the case implies that certain individuals may be using it as a power play. Speculation has risen about a potential difference of opinion between Red Bull’s majority owners from Thailand and the Austrian energy drinks company.

Rival F1 teams, including McLaren, called on Formula One Management and the FIA to ensure greater transparency in the handling of the matter by Red Bull. McLaren CEO Zak Brown expressed the need for full transparency within the sport and urged the sanctioning body to address any unanswered questions.
